The three institutions are not likely to consider your LLM grades... CityU only considers LLM if you got an extremely good grade (i.e high distinction)
Looking at your core subjects you did pretty well except for litigation, but then litigation wasn't really a core subject for all three institutions. Only HKU looks into the average grade of core modules (i.e contract, tort, equity and trust etc.) more than your overall average. HKU seems to be a more suitable choice for you.
Besides, HKU has 340 places this year and the lower quartile they accepted last year was around 57- 58% for full time HKU PCLL.

This year is still being affected by double cohort. In 2012, HKU admitted 268 students to the five-year joint degree programs (BBA law, Govt & Laws and BA law) and they will graduate this year. The 2011 intake for joint degree programs was only 150.
